Art Directors Guild Announces Timeline for 28th ADG Awards for Production Design

-

The Art Directors Guild (ADG, IATSE Local 800) has announced the timeline for its 28th Annual Excellence in Production Design Awards, which will return to the InterContinental Los Angeles Downtown on Saturday, Feb. 10, 2024.

The ADG Awards continue to recognize Art Directors Guild members and the creative work they do in theatrical motion pictures, television, commercials, animated features and music videos.

28TH ANNUAL EXCELLENCE IN PRODUCTION DESIGN AWARDS TIMELINE*:

Monday, Sep. 18, 2023: Submissions open for all Television, Feature Film, Commercial and Music Video categories
Monday, Oct. 30, 2023: Submissions close for all Television, Commercial and Music Video categories
Monday, Dec. 4, 2023: Submissions close for all Feature Film categories
Monday, Dec. 11, 2023: Online voting begins for all categories
Friday, Jan. 5, 2024 (5 p.m. PT): Online nominee voting ends for all categories
Tuesday, Jan. 9, 2024: Nominations announced
Monday, Jan. 22, 2024: Online voting begins for winners in each category
Thursday, Feb. 8, 2024 (5 p.m. PT): Final online voting closes
Saturday, Feb. 10, 2024: Winners announced at the 28th Annual ADG Awards ceremony
*Dates are subject to change.

To be eligible, theatrical motion pictures, television series, commercials, animated features and music videos made in the U.S. or Canada must be produced under an IATSE agreement. Foreign entries are acceptable without restrictions. Submission forms will be accessible at www.awards.adg.org, once submissions open. Rules for the 28th Annual Awards can be found here.

ABOUT THE ART DIRECTORS GUILD:

Established in 1937, the Art Directors Guild (IATSE Local 800) represents 3,300 members who work throughout the world in film, television and theater as: Production Designers and Art Directors; Scenic, Title and Graphic Artists; Set Designers and Model Makers; Illustrators and Matte Artists. ADG 800’s ongoing activities include a Film Society screening series, the annual “Excellence in Production Design Awards” gala, a bimonthly craft magazine (PERSPECTIVE), figure drawing and other creative workshops, as well as extensive technology and craft training programs.
